summ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orPascal Mehnert2018-06-14 16:03:45 +0200
committerPascal Mehnert2018-06-14 16:03:45 +0200
commit894b9722cb6cfeea8a2a2ef97b8e2e6b643c3a38 (patch)
tree7f97e7110480a0b90e4f6123b1ea5cce34827e28
downloadaur-894b9722cb6cfeea8a2a2ef97b8e2e6b643c3a38.tar.gz
Initail commit
-rw-r--r--.SRCINFO20
-rw-r--r--PKGBUILD38
2 files changed, 58 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..72e8fe1ee119
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,20 @@
+pkgbase = nvimpager-git
+ pkgdesc = Use nvim as a pager to view manpages, diffs, etc with nvim's syntax highlighting
+ pkgver = 0.4.r2.ga8270a9
+ pkgrel = 1
+ url = https://github.com/lucc/nvimpager
+ arch = any
+ license = BSD
+ makedepends = curl
+ makedepends = git
+ makedepends = pandoc
+ depends = neovim>=0.3.0
+ depends = bash
+ depends = procps-ng
+ provides = nvimpager
+ conflicts = nvimpager
+ source = git+https://github.com/lucc/nvimpager.git
+ sha256sums = SKIP
+
+pkgname = nvimpager-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..92acd3a0a225
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,38 @@
+# Maintainer: Pascal Mehnert <gargoil@posteo.de>
+
+pkgname=nvimpager-git
+pkgver=0.4.r2.ga8270a9
+pkgrel=1
+pkgdesc="Use nvim as a pager to view manpages, diffs, etc with nvim's syntax highlighting"
+arch=('any')
+url='https://github.com/lucc/nvimpager'
+license=('BSD')
+depends=('neovim>=0.3.0' 'bash' 'procps-ng')
+makedepends=('curl' 'git' 'pandoc')
+conflicts=('nvimpager')
+provides=('nvimpager')
+source=('git+https://github.com/lucc/nvimpager.git')
+sha256sums=('SKIP')
+
+pkgver() {
+ cd nvimpager/
+
+ if GITTAG="$(git describe --abbrev=0 --tags 2>/dev/null)"; then
+ printf '%s.r%s.g%s' \
+ "$(sed -e "s/^${pkgname%%-git}//" -e 's/^[-_/a-zA-Z]\+//' -e 's/[-_+]/./g' <<< ${GITTAG})" \
+ "$(git rev-list --count ${GITTAG}..)" \
+ "$(git log -1 --format='%h')"
+ else
+ printf '0.r%s.g%s' \
+ "$(git rev-list --count master)" \
+ "$(git log -1 --format='%h')"
+ fi
+}
+
+package() {
+ cd nvimpager/
+
+ make PREFIX="/usr" DESTDIR="${pkgdir}" install
+
+ install -Dm644 LICENSE "$pkgdir/usr/share/licenses/vimpager/LICENSE"
+}